Question to the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government:
To ask the Secretary of State for Housing, Communities and Local Government, what steps his Department is taking to facilitate downsizing for social housing tenants under-occupying homes.
The government encourages the efficient use of existing housing stock.
When it comes to social housing, local authorities and housing associations are encouraged to support under-occupiers to transfer to smaller properties, including through mutual exchanges.
In the five-step plan for delivering a decade of renewal for social and affordable housing published on 2 July (which can be found on gov.uk here), the government set out its intention to review how effectively social housing providers use their properties, and explore ways to encourage movement within the sector through mutual exchanges (particularly where homes are overcrowded and under-occupied).
